	XThese files relate to the ``rntool'' command which allows news to be
	Xread within a SunView window using ``tooltool'' and ``rn''.  The
	Xsoftware has only been tested on a Sun 3/50.  The files include:
	X
	X	Makefile	- makefile to install files *
	X	README		- this file *
	X	news.icon	- icon displayed when new news is present
	X	nonews.icon	- icon display when there is no new news
	X	rn.sh		- main news reading "csh" shell script *
	X	rn.tt		- tooltool application description file *
	X	rntool		- start-up shell script *
	X	rntool.1	- manual page for tool *
	X
	X"rntool" is normally invoked by a user (e.g. in $HOME/.suntools or
	X$HOME/.rootmenu) and this in turn invokes "tooltool".
	X
	X* Note that some files are currently put under "/usr/news".  This may
	Xwell need to be changed depending on the local configuration. All the
	Xfiles except the icon files should be scanned for this string and
	Xedited appropriately before the files are installed (by running
	X"make").
	X
	X"rn.sh" makes use of the "sunbell" program to sound the bell when news
	Xarrived. If this is not available then "rn.sh" should be edited at this
	Xpoint to edit out the call to "sunbell" and to sound the bell in some
	Xother way if desired. An example is given as a comment in the shell
	Xscript.

sed 's/^	X//' << \SHAR_EOF > 'rn.sh'
	X#!/bin/csh -f
	X#
	X#	rn.sh - News reading program - check for news every so often,
	X#		change icon etc. when news is present/absent.
	X#
	X#	Normally invoked by "tooltool -f rn.tt".
	X#
	X#	Written by Jonathan Bowen, July/August 1988
	X#	Based on "newsreader", written by Jonathan Bowen, October 1987
	X#	Based on a "newsread" shell script by Jeremy Jacob, 9 Oct 87
	X#	Updated by Jonathan Bowen, February 1989
	X#
	X
	Xonintr -
	X
	Xif (! ${?ROOT}) then
	X  set ROOT=/usr/news
	Xendif
	X
	Xset PATH=/bin:/usr/bin:/ucb/bin:/usr/local/bin:$ROOT/bin
	X
	Xif (! ${?PROGNAME}) then
	X  set PROGNAME=`basename $0`
	Xendif
	X
	X# Directory containing icons for this shell script
	Xset ICONDIR=$ROOT/images
	X
	X# Interval in seconds between checks for news
	Xset INTERVAL=600
	X
	X# BEL is the ASCII bell character (octal 007)
	Xset BEL=`echo -n x | tr x '\007'`
	X# ESC is the ASCII escape character (octal 033)
	Xset ESC=`echo -n x | tr x '\033'`
	X
	X# "rn" is the default newsreading program unless NEWSPROG is set
	Xif (! ${?NEWSPROG}) then
	X  set NEWSPROG=rn
	Xendif
	X
	Xecho -n "${ESC}]L${ESC}\"
	X
	Xwhile (1)
	X
	X  echo -n "${ESC}[2t"
	X  set NEWNEWS=`rn -c`
	X
	X  if (! $#NEWNEWS) then
	X    echo -n "${ESC}]I$ICONDIR/nonews.icon${ESC}\"
	X    echo -n "${ESC}]l$PROGNAME - No news${ESC}\"
	X
	X# Check for new news
	X    while (! $#NEWNEWS)
	X      onintr read
	X      sleep $INTERVAL
	X      set NEWNEWS=`rn -c`
	X      goto cont
	X# Read news anyway
	Xread:
	X      onintr -
	X      echo -n "${ESC}]l$PROGNAME - Reading news${ESC}\${ESC}[1t"
	X      clear
	X      $NEWSPROG
	X      clear
	X      echo -n "${ESC}[2t${ESC}]l$PROGNAME - No news${ESC}\"
	Xcont:
	X      onintr -
	X    end
	X
	X# Enable "News" icon.
	X    echo -n "${ESC}]I$ICONDIR/news.icon${ESC}\"
	X# Sound bell  ("Read   all    a------bout   it!")
	X    sunbell     200 50 200 50 100 50 400 50 100
	X# Sound bell twice (use if "sunbell" is not available)
	X#   echo -n "${BEL}" ; sleep 1; echo -n "${BEL}"
	X# Sound bell and make icon visible  (Not safe if screen is locked)
	X#   echo -n "${BEL}${ESC}[5t" ; echo -n "${BEL}"
	X  endif
	X
	X# Read new news
	X  echo -n "${ESC}]I$ICONDIR/news.icon${ESC}\"
	X  echo -n "${ESC}]l$PROGNAME - News${ESC}\"
	X  clear
	X  $NEWSPROG
	X  clear
	X
	Xend
	X
